USA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Out-of-state part-time undergraduates at USA paid an average of $658 per credit hour in 2019-2020. The average for in-state students was $329 per credit hour.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$7,896$15,792
Fees$500$500
Books and Supplies$1,200$1,200
On Campus Room and Board$7,900$7,900
On Campus Other Expenses$5,370$5,370

USA CompSci BS Student Debt

One way to think about how much a school will cost is to look at how much in student loans that you have to take out to get your degree. CompSci students who received their bachelor’s degree at USA took out an average of $27,500 in student loans. That is 20% higher than the national average of $22,937.

How Much Can You Make With a BS in CompSci From USA?

$43,240 Average Salary
Below Average Earnings Boost

compsci who receive their bachelor’s degree from USA make an average of $43,240 a year during the early days of their career. That is 35% lower than the national average of $66,348.

USA Bachelor’s Student Diversity for CompSci

54 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
18.5% Women
25.9%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
There were 54 bachelor’s degrees in compsci awarded during the 2019-2020 academic year. Information about those students is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

About 18.5% of the students who received their BS in compsci in 2019-2020 were women. This is less than the nationwide number of 20.6%.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Of those graduates who received a bachelor’s degree in compsci at USA in 2019-2020, 25.9% were racial-ethnic minorities*. This is lower than the nationwide number of 40%.
